Social Services Europe is looking for a Researcher to carry out a study at European level on existing and effective interventions made at national level in the field of recruitment and retention of staff in the Social Care sector.

Social Services are one of the biggest job creators in Europe today with over 1.7 million new jobs created since 2008 and play a key role in empowering all people to play an active role in society. Whereas the sector’s job creation potential is very clear, there is less awareness at European level regarding the actual interventions and activities done at national level to attract and retain sufficient workers into the sector. Social Services Europe -and its member organisations- are looking for research input to feed our work around European policies and instruments such as European Semester, the European Pillar of Social Rights, European Civil and Social Dialogue, etc.
